Sleepy Hollow Statistics Back to top
  • Population (2000): 9,212
  • Land Area (2000): 5.884 square kilometers
  • Water Area (2000): 7.349 square kilometers
Back to top
Houses (2000): 3,253

Sleepy Hollow Citizen Type
Type Population Percent
Color 0 Box Citizen by birth 5,421 58.83%
Color 1 Box Naturalized immigrant 1,121 12.17%
Color 2 Box Not a citizen 2,672 29.00%
